Summary
The Patsy is an American film comedy first released in 1964,
directed by Jerry Lewis.
The film stars Jerry Lewis, Ina Balin, Everett Sloane, Phil Harris and Keenan Wynn.

Credits
- Director: Jerry Lewis
- Script: Jerry Lewis, Bill Richmond
- Photo: W. Wallace Kelley
- Music: David Raksin
- Cast: Jerry Lewis (Stanley Belt), Ina Balin (Ellen Betz), Everett Sloane (Caryl Fergusson), Phil Harris (Chic Wymore), Keenan Wynn (Harry Silver), Peter Lorre (Morgan Heywood), John Carradine (Bruce Alden), Hans Conried (Prof. Mulerr), Richard Deacon (Sy Devore), Scatman Crothers (Shoeshine Boy), Del Moore (Policeman), Neil Hamilton (The Barber), Buddy Lester (Copa Cafe MC), Nancy Kulp (Helen, Theatergoer), Lloyd Thaxton (Himself), Norman Alden (Bully at the Gym), Jack Albertson (Theatergoer with Helen), Henry Slate (Paul), Gavin Gordon (Executive on Golf Course), Ned Wynn (Band Member), Rhonda Fleming (Herself), Phil Foster (Mayo Sloan), Hedda Hopper (Herself), George Raft (Himself), The Four Step Brothers (Themselves), Mel Tormé (Himself), Ed Wynn (Himself), Clyde Adler (Bald Man), Murray Alper (Bowler), Phil Arnold (Bartender), Richard Bakalyan (Boy at Spring Hop), Billy Beck (Band Member), Billy Bletcher (Table Captain #3 at Italian Cafe), Don Brodie (Bowler), Robert Carson (Table Captain #2 at Italian Cafe), Chick Chandler (Hedda Hopper’s Escort), Harry Cheshire (Police Sergeant), Robert Christian (Barbershop Porter), Adele Claire (Elderly Lady), Jerome Cowan (Business Executive), Lorraine Crawford (Manicurist), Bob Denner (Band Member), Fay DeWitt (Woman at Party), Jerry Dexter (Bit part), John Dexter (Radio Newscaster), Jerry Dunphy (TV Newscaster), Isabelle Dwan (Elderly Lady), William Enge (Barbershop Porter), Herbie Faye (Tailor), Fritz Feld (Maitre D’), Joe Finnegan (Himself (Reporter at Party)), Nancy Patricia Fisher (Waitress), Kathleen Freeman (Katie), Marianne Gaba (Waitress), John Gallaudet (Barney), Richard Gehman (Himself (Reporter at Party)), Bob Harvey (Waiter), Jerry Hausner (Floorman), Robert Ivers (Boy at Spring Hop), Bobby Johnson (Barbershop Porter), Joey Johnson (Barbershop Porter), Byron Kane (Table Captain #1 at Italian Cafe), Norman Leavitt (Newsboy), Gary Lewis (Boy at Spring Hop), William Leyden (TV Announcer), David Lipp (Frozen-stare Man), Darlene Lucht (Checkroom Girl), John Macchia (Student), Marlene Maddox (Waitress), Michael Mahoney (Copa Cafe Heckler), John Marlowe (Waiter), Dee Jay Mattis (The Broad), Bob May (Fireworks Boy), Peggy Mondo (Bowler), Mantan Moreland (Barbershop Porter), Hollis Morrison (Juke Box), Terry Naylor (Barbershop Customer), Quinn O’Hara (Cigarette Girl), Barbara Pepper (Bowler), Sherwood Price (Bellboy), Joanne C. Quakenbush (Waitress), Bill Richmond (Piano player), Sheila Rogers (Woman at Party), Edmundo Ros (Bandleader), Michael Ross (Truck Driver), Benny Rubin (Waiter #1 at Italian Cafe), Eddie Ryder (Man at Party), Ernest Schworck (Bit Part), Vernon Scott (Himself), June Smaney (Pedicurist), Mabel Smaney (Woman in Phone Booth), Walter Smith (Barbershop Porter), Harry Spear (Salesman), Anthony Spinelli (Man on the Phone), Joe Stabil (Lead Musician), Ed Sullivan (Himself), Joan Swift (Girl), William Wellman Jr. (Band Member), Edward C. Widdis (Bit Part), Dave Willock (Alec)
- Country: USA
- Language: English
- Runtime: 101 min
